Gusto vs ADP RUN 2026: Small Business Payroll Compared
Gusto is the modern self-serve option built for simplicity. ADP is the enterprise-grade platform with 24/7 support and a seamless path to mid-market. The right choice depends on where you are today and where you plan to be in 18 months.
Quick Verdict
Gusto wins for teams under 25 on price, self-serve experience, and included features. ADP wins for teams over 25 on scalability, 24/7 phone support, and the seamless upgrade path to ADP Workforce Now. The crossover point is around 25 to 50 employees, where ADP's lower per-employee cost and enterprise features start to outweigh Gusto's simplicity.
Pricing at Multiple Team Sizes
| Employees | Gusto Simple | ADP RUN (est.) | Cheaper |
|---|---|---|---|
| 5 | $76/mo | $104/mo | Gusto by $28/mo |
| 10 | $106/mo | $129/mo | Gusto by $23/mo |
| 25 | $196/mo | $204/mo | Gusto by $8/mo |
| 50 | $346/mo | $329/mo | ADP by $17/mo |
| 100 | $646/mo | $579/mo | ADP by $67/mo |
ADP pricing is estimated from published sources. ADP requires a custom quote; actual pricing may differ. Gusto Simple plan shown.

Key Differences That Matter
Signup experience
Gusto lets you sign up, add employees, and run payroll entirely online with no sales call. ADP requires talking to a sales representative, which means you cannot see final pricing before committing to a conversation. For business owners who prefer self-serve, this is a significant friction point.
Support model
ADP offers 24/7 phone support on all tiers. Gusto limits phone support to Monday through Friday, 6am to 5pm Pacific. If your business runs payroll on weekends or needs urgent help outside business hours, ADP has a clear advantage.
Scalability
ADP RUN seamlessly upgrades to ADP Workforce Now when you outgrow the small business product. No data migration, no re-onboarding. Gusto does not have an enterprise product; businesses with 100+ employees typically outgrow it and switch providers entirely.
W-2/1099 filing
Gusto includes W-2 and 1099 filing on all plans. ADP charges extra for this on lower tiers. For a small business with contractors, this hidden cost can add $100+ to your annual ADP bill.
Benefits at lower price points
Gusto includes benefits admin on every plan starting at $46/month. ADP includes benefits but the higher base price means you pay more per month for equivalent functionality until you reach 25+ employees.
Choose Gusto if...
- ✓You have under 25 employees and want self-serve simplicity
- ✓You prefer transparent, published pricing with no sales calls
- ✓You need benefits admin included at the lowest price point
- ✓You value interface design and mobile app quality
- ✓You want 200+ integrations with your existing tools
Choose ADP RUN if...
- ✓You plan to grow past 50 employees within 18 months
- ✓You need 24/7 phone support, not just business hours
- ✓You want a seamless upgrade path to enterprise payroll
- ✓You need advanced compliance tools for multi-state operations
- ✓You prefer working with a dedicated payroll specialist
